Cách sử dụng excel vba len để tối ưu hóa công việc của bạn

Chủ đề excel vba len: Len() là một hàm quan trọng trong VBA giúp tính toán độ dài của chuỗi kể cả khoảng trắng. Việc sử dụng hàm này trong VBA rất đơn giản, chỉ cần truyền chuỗi cần tính độ dài vào len() là được. Với tính năng này, việc xử lý dữ liệu trong Excel VBA trở nên thuận tiện hơn bao giờ hết.

Tìm hiểu về cách sử dụng hàm Len() trong VBA để tính độ dài của một chuỗi trong Excel?

Để tính độ dài của một chuỗi trong Excel bằng VBA, chúng ta có thể sử dụng hàm Len(). Hàm Len() trả về độ dài của chuỗi đầu vào, bao gồm cả khoảng trắng.
Dưới đây là cách sử dụng hàm Len() trong VBA để tính độ dài của một chuỗi:
1. Mở Excel và tạo một module mới trong VBA. Bạn có thể làm điều này bằng cách bấm tổ hợp phím ALT + F11, sau đó chọn \"Insert\" và chọn \"Module\".
2. Trong module VBA, bạn có thể tạo một function hoặc một sub để tính độ dài của chuỗi. Dưới đây là một ví dụ về một function sử dụng hàm Len():
```
Function TinhDoDaiChuoi(chuoi As String) As Integer
Dim doDai As Integer
doDai = Len(chuoi)

TinhDoDaiChuoi = doDai
End Function
```
3. Lưu và đóng module VBA.
4. Bạn có thể sử dụng hàm TinhDoDaiChuoi (hoặc tên function khác mà bạn đã đặt) trong Excel để tính độ dài của một chuỗi. Nhập một chuỗi bất kỳ vào một ô trong bảng tính và sử dụng công thức sau:
```
=TinhDoDaiChuoi(A1)
```
Trong đó, A1 là địa chỉ ô chứa chuỗi cần tính độ dài.
5. Bấm Enter để tính độ dài của chuỗi.
Kết quả sẽ hiển thị độ dài của chuỗi trong ô kết quả.

Tìm hiểu về cách sử dụng hàm Len() trong VBA để tính độ dài của một chuỗi trong Excel?
Làm Chủ BIM: Bí Quyết Chiến Thắng Mọi Gói Thầu Xây Dựng
Làm Chủ BIM: Bí Quyết Chiến Thắng Mọi Gói Thầu Xây Dựng

Hàm Len() trong VBA được sử dụng để làm gì?

Hàm Len() trong VBA được sử dụng để trả về độ dài của một chuỗi đã cho. Khi sử dụng hàm này, chúng ta có thể biết được số ký tự trong một chuỗi, bao gồm cả khoảng trắng.
Để sử dụng hàm Len(), cú pháp được sử dụng là Len(String), trong đó \"String\" là chuỗi cần kiểm tra độ dài. Ví dụ, nếu chúng ta muốn biết độ dài của chuỗi \"Hello World\", chúng ta có thể sử dụng hàm Len() như sau:
Dim length As Integer
length = Len(\"Hello World\")
MsgBox length
Kết quả sẽ là 11, do chuỗi \"Hello World\" có 11 ký tự.
Thông qua việc sử dụng hàm Len() trong VBA, chúng ta có thể kiểm tra độ dài của một chuỗi và sử dụng thông tin này trong việc xử lý dữ liệu hoặc kiểm tra điều kiện trong chương trình VBA.

Hàm Len() trong VBA được sử dụng để làm gì?

Cú pháp của hàm Len() trong VBA là gì?

Cú pháp của hàm Len() trong VBA là Len(String), trong đó String là tham số đầu vào đại diện cho chuỗi cần tính độ dài. Nó sẽ trả về độ dài của chuỗi đầu vào, bao gồm cả khoảng trắng. Để sử dụng hàm Len() trong VBA, bạn có thể làm theo các bước sau:
1. Mở trình editor VBA trong Excel bằng cách nhấp chuột phải vào một sheet và chọn \"View Code\" (Xem mã).
2. Chọn một sự kiện hoặc tạo một sub/function (chức năng/phương thức) mới để sử dụng hàm Len().
3. Nhập cú pháp sau:
Dim length As Integer
length = Len(String)

Trong đó, \"String\" là chuỗi cần tính độ dài và \"length\" là biến để lưu giá trị trả về của hàm Len().
4. Sử dụng biến \"length\" để tiếp tục xử lý trong chương trình VBA của bạn.
Ví dụ sử dụng hàm Len() trong VBA:
Sub TinhDoDai()
Dim chuoi As String
Dim doDai As Integer

chuoi = \"Hello World\"
doDai = Len(chuoi)

MsgBox \"Độ dài của chuỗi là: \" & doDai
End Sub
Khi bạn chạy chương trình này, một hộp thoại sẽ hiển thị thông báo với nội dung \"Độ dài của chuỗi là: 11\" (vì chuỗi \"Hello World\" có 11 ký tự, bao gồm cả khoảng trắng).

Cú pháp của hàm Len() trong VBA là gì?
Từ Nghiện Game Đến Lập Trình Ra Game
Hành Trình Kiến Tạo Tương Lai Số - Bố Mẹ Cần Biết

Hàm Len() trong VBA trả về giá trị gì?

Hàm Len() trả về độ dài của chuỗi đã cho bao gồm cả khoảng trắng. Để sử dụng hàm Len() trong VBA, bạn có thể tuân thủ cú pháp sau: Len(Chuỗi). Ví dụ: Len(\"abc\") sẽ trả về giá trị 3, vì chuỗi \"abc\" có 3 ký tự.

Hàm Len() trong VBA trả về giá trị gì?

Excel VBA - Hàm chuỗi Left-Right

Hãy xem video về Excel VBA - Hàm chuỗi Left-Right để học cách sử dụng các hàm chuỗi mạnh mẽ này. Đây là một công cụ quan trọng để thao tác với dữ liệu văn bản trong Excel. Bấm vào đây để khám phá thêm!

Lập trình Scratch cho trẻ 8-11 tuổi
Ghép Khối Tư Duy - Kiến Tạo Tương Lai Số

46) VBA excel - Hàm len

Muốn làm việc hiệu quả với VBA Excel? Hãy xem video về Hàm len để tìm hiểu cách sử dụng hàm này để tính độ dài của một chuỗi. Đây là một kiến thức cần thiết cho mọi developer Excel. Xem video ngay!

Có thể sử dụng hàm Len() trong VBA để tính độ dài của chuỗi chứa khoảng trắng hay không?

Có, hàm Len() trong VBA có thể được sử dụng để tính độ dài của chuỗi bao gồm cả khoảng trắng. Bạn có thể làm như sau:
1. Mở chương trình Excel và nhấp chuột phải vào tờ bảng mà bạn muốn sử dụng hàm Len().
2. Chọn \"View Code\" trong danh sách tùy chọn hiển thị.
3. Trình biên dịch VBA sẽ mở ra. Trong trình biên dịch, bạn có thể viết mã VBA của mình.
4. Để sử dụng hàm Len(), bạn cần định nghĩa một biến chuỗi và gán giá trị cho nó. Ví dụ, bạn có thể viết mã như sau:
Dim myString As String
myString = \"Hello World\"

Đây là một ví dụ, bạn có thể thay đổi giá trị chuỗi theo ý muốn.
5. Tiếp theo, bạn có thể sử dụng hàm Len() để tính độ dài của chuỗi và in kết quả ra màn hình. Ví dụ:
Dim length As Integer
length = Len(myString)
MsgBox \"Độ dài của chuỗi là: \" & length

Hàm Len() sẽ trả về giá trị là độ dài của chuỗi đã được định nghĩa, bao gồm cả các khoảng trắng. Kết quả sẽ được hiển thị trong một hộp thoại thông báo.
6. Sau khi hoàn thành mã, bạn có thể lưu và đóng trình biên dịch VBA.
7. Quay trở lại tờ bảng Excel và chọn một ô trống để thử nghiệm mã VBA vừa viết.
8. Nhấn tổ hợp phím Alt + F8 để hiển thị danh sách Macros.
9. Chọn tên của macro mà bạn đã tạo và nhấn nút \"Run\" để thực thi mã.
10. Kết quả sẽ được hiển thị trong một hộp thoại thông báo và bạn có thể xem độ dài của chuỗi đã tính.
Đó là cách sử dụng hàm Len() trong VBA để tính độ dài của chuỗi bao gồm cả khoảng trắng. Bạn có thể tùy chỉnh mã VBA theo nhu cầu của mình để tính toán và xử lý các chuỗi khác.

Có thể sử dụng hàm Len() trong VBA để tính độ dài của chuỗi chứa khoảng trắng hay không?

_HOOK_

Thông qua ví dụ, hãy mô tả cách sử dụng hàm Len() trong VBA để đo độ dài của một chuỗi.

Để sử dụng hàm Len() trong VBA để đo độ dài của một chuỗi, bạn cần làm theo các bước sau đây:
1. Mở Excel và nhấn tổ hợp phím Alt + F11 để mở trình biên dịch VBA.
2. Trên cửa sổ VBA, nhấp chuột phải vào một dự án VBA và chọn Insert -> Module để tạo một module mới.
3. Trong module mới tạo, bạn có thể khai báo một biến chuỗi để lưu trữ chuỗi cần đo độ dài. Ví dụ: Dim myString As String
4. Tiếp theo, bạn có thể gán một giá trị cho biến chuỗi này. Ví dụ: myString = \"Hello World\"
5. Cuối cùng, bạn có thể sử dụng hàm Len() để tính độ dài của chuỗi đã cho. Ví dụ: Dim length As Integer length = Len(myString)
6. Để xem kết quả, bạn có thể sử dụng hàm MsgBox() để hiển thị độ dài của chuỗi. Ví dụ: MsgBox \"Độ dài của chuỗi là: \" & length
Sau khi bạn đã hoàn thành các bước trên, khi chạy mã VBA, một hộp thoại sẽ xuất hiện, hiển thị độ dài của chuỗi đã cho là \"11\" trong ví dụ trên.

Thông qua ví dụ, hãy mô tả cách sử dụng hàm Len() trong VBA để đo độ dài của một chuỗi.
Lập trình cho học sinh 8-18 tuổi
Học Lập Trình Sớm - Làm Chủ Tương Lai Số

Hàm Len() trong VBA có thể dùng để xử lý các chuỗi có ký tự đặc biệt không?

Hàm Len() trong VBA có thể được sử dụng để xử lý các chuỗi có ký tự đặc biệt. Bạn có thể làm theo các bước sau để sử dụng hàm Len() trong VBA:
1. Mở Excel và nhấp chuột phải vào thanh Ribbon. Chọn \"Customize the Ribbon\" để hiển thị hộp thoại Tuỳ chỉnh Ribbon.
2. Trong hộp thoại Tuỳ chỉnh Ribbon, chọn tab nơi bạn muốn đưa Macros hoặc VBA lên, chẳng hạn như tab \"Data\" hoặc \"Home\".
3. Nhấp vào nút \"New Group\" để tạo một nhóm mới trong tab đã chọn.
4. Chọn Macros hoặc VBA mà bạn muốn đưa lên Ribbon, sau đó nhấp vào nút \"Add >>\" để thêm chúng vào nhóm đã tạo.
5. Khi các Macros hoặc VBA đã được thêm vào nhóm, nhấp vào nút \"OK\" để đóng hộp thoại Tuỳ chỉnh Ribbon.
6. Bây giờ, bạn đã đưa Macros hoặc VBA lên Ribbon và có thể truy cập chúng để thực hiện các thao tác xử lý chuỗi có ký tự đặc biệt.
Nếu bạn có một tệp tin cụ thể muốn tham khảo về cách sử dụng hàm Len() trong VBA cho xử lý chuỗi có ký tự đặc biệt, bạn có thể nhấp vào liên kết thứ 3 trong kết quả tìm kiếm để tải xuống tệp tin.

Hàm Len() trong VBA có thể dùng để xử lý các chuỗi có ký tự đặc biệt không?

Tại sao việc hiểu cách sử dụng hàm Len() trong VBA quan trọng đối với việc phân tích và xử lý dữ liệu trong Excel?

Cách sử dụng hàm Len() trong VBA là một khả năng quan trọng khi làm việc với dữ liệu trong Excel. Hàm này sẽ trả về độ dài của một chuỗi đã cho, bao gồm cả các ký tự khoảng trắng.
Việc hiểu cách sử dụng hàm Len() trong VBA là quan trọng vì nó cung cấp thông tin về độ dài của một chuỗi. Điều này rất hữu ích khi bạn cần phân tích dữ liệu trong bảng tính Excel. Dưới đây là một số lợi ích cụ thể của việc sử dụng hàm Len():
1. Xác định độ dài chuỗi: Khi bạn muốn biết độ dài của một chuỗi cụ thể, bạn có thể sử dụng hàm Len(). Điều này rất hữu ích khi bạn muốn kiểm tra xem một chuỗi có đúng số ký tự quy định hay không. Ví dụ, nếu bạn muốn đảm bảo rằng số điện thoại nhập vào có đúng 10 ký tự, bạn có thể sử dụng hàm Len() để xác định độ dài của số điện thoại đó.
2. Kiểm tra xem chuỗi có rỗng hay không: Khi làm việc với dữ liệu trong Excel, có thể xảy ra trường hợp một ô trong bảng tính không có giá trị. Sử dụng hàm Len(), bạn có thể kiểm tra xem một chuỗi có độ dài bằng 0 hay không. Điều này giúp bạn xác định các ô trống trong bảng tính và xử lý chúng một cách thích hợp.
3. Cắt chuỗi: Đôi khi, bạn cần cắt một phần của chuỗi để phân tích dữ liệu. Bằng cách sử dụng hàm Len(), bạn có thể xác định vị trí của các ký tự trong chuỗi và cắt chuỗi đó thành các phần khác nhau. Ví dụ, nếu bạn muốn lấy phần đầu của một chuỗi, bạn có thể sử dụng hàm Len() để xác định độ dài của chuỗi và sau đó cắt chuỗi theo vị trí tương ứng.
Tóm lại, việc hiểu cách sử dụng hàm Len() trong VBA là quan trọng để phân tích và xử lý dữ liệu trong Excel. Nó giúp bạn xác định độ dài của chuỗi, kiểm tra xem chuỗi có rỗng hay không và cắt chuỗi thành các phần khác nhau.

Tại sao việc hiểu cách sử dụng hàm Len() trong VBA quan trọng đối với việc phân tích và xử lý dữ liệu trong Excel?

Hỏi đáp VBA excel 1 - Tạo nút tăng giảm, liên kết dữ liệu các sheets.

Bạn đang gặp khó khăn khi lập trình VBA Excel? Xem video Hỏi đáp VBA excel 1 để tìm hiểu cách tạo nút tăng giảm và liên kết dữ liệu giữa các Sheets. Đừng lo lắng, video này sẽ giúp bạn giải quyết mọi thắc mắc. Bấm vào đây để xem ngay!

Ngoài hàm Len(), còn có những hàm nào khác trong VBA để xử lý độ dài chuỗi?

Trong VBA, ngoài hàm Len() để xử lý độ dài của chuỗi, chúng ta còn có những hàm khác sau:
1. Hàm LenB(): Tương tự như hàm Len(), hàm LenB() trả về độ dài của chuỗi trong byte thay vì ký tự. Điều này đặc biệt hữu ích khi làm việc với các ngôn ngữ không phải là ngôn ngữ Latin.
Cú pháp: LenB(String)
Ví dụ:
Dim str As String
str = \"Chuỗi VBA\"
MsgBox LenB(str) \' Kết quả là 12
2. Hàm LenRev(): Hàm LenRev() cũng trả về độ dài của chuỗi, nhưng đếm từ phải sang trái thay vì từ trái sang phải. Điều này hữu ích khi bạn muốn đảo ngược chuỗi.
Cú pháp: LenRev(String)
Ví dụ:
Dim str As String
str = \"Chuỗi VBA\"
MsgBox LenRev(str) \' Kết quả là 9
3. Hàm String(): Hàm String() tạo ra một chuỗi mới bằng cách lặp lại một ký tự cho một số lần nhất định.
Cú pháp: String(number, character)
Ví dụ:
MsgBox String(5, \"a\") \' Kết quả là \"aaaaa\"
4. Hàm Mid(): Hàm Mid() trích xuất một phần của chuỗi dựa trên vị trí bắt đầu và độ dài. Hàm này hữu ích khi bạn muốn lấy một phần nhất định của chuỗi.
Cú pháp: Mid(String, start, length)
Ví dụ:
Dim str As String
str = \"Chuỗi VBA\"
MsgBox Mid(str, 4, 5) \' Kết quả là \"i VBA\"
Như vậy, ngoài hàm Len(), chúng ta còn có các hàm LenB(), LenRev(), String(), Mid() để xử lý độ dài của chuỗi trong VBA.

Ngoài hàm Len(), còn có những hàm nào khác trong VBA để xử lý độ dài chuỗi?

Hãy mô tả cách áp dụng hàm Len() trong VBA để kiểm tra và xử lý các lỗi như chuỗi không tồn tại hoặc rỗng.

Để áp dụng hàm Len() trong VBA để kiểm tra và xử lý các lỗi như chuỗi không tồn tại hoặc rỗng, bạn có thể làm theo các bước sau:
1. Kiểm tra chuỗi có tồn tại hay không: Trước tiên, để kiểm tra xem chuỗi có tồn tại hay không, bạn có thể sử dụng hàm Len() để đo độ dài của chuỗi. Nếu độ dài của chuỗi là 0, tức là chuỗi không tồn tại hoặc rỗng.
2. Xử lý lỗi chuỗi không tồn tại hoặc rỗng: Nếu chuỗi không tồn tại hoặc rỗng, bạn có thể thực hiện các hành động xử lý lỗi tương ứng. Ví dụ, bạn có thể hiển thị thông báo lỗi cho người dùng, yêu cầu người dùng cung cấp một chuỗi hợp lệ hoặc thực hiện các xử lý khác tuỳ theo yêu cầu của công việc.
Dưới đây là một ví dụ cụ thể về cách áp dụng hàm Len() trong VBA để kiểm tra và xử lý lỗi chuỗi không tồn tại hoặc rỗng:
```vba
Sub KiemTraChuoi()
Dim myString As String

\' Nhập chuỗi từ người dùng
myString = InputBox(\"Nhập vào một chuỗi:\")

\' Kiểm tra độ dài của chuỗi
If Len(myString) = 0 Then
\' Chuỗi không tồn tại hoặc rỗng
MsgBox \"Chuỗi không tồn tại hoặc rỗng. Vui lòng nhập một chuỗi hợp lệ.\"
Else
\' Chuỗi tồn tại
MsgBox \"Chuỗi có độ dài \" & Len(myString)
End If
End Sub
```
Trong ví dụ trên, chương trình sẽ yêu cầu người dùng nhập vào một chuỗi. Sau đó, nó sẽ sử dụng hàm Len() để kiểm tra độ dài của chuỗi. Nếu độ dài bằng 0, chương trình sẽ hiển thị thông báo lỗi. Nếu độ dài khác 0, chương trình sẽ hiển thị thông báo với độ dài của chuỗi.
Lưu ý rằng ví dụ trên chỉ là một cách áp dụng hàm Len() để kiểm tra và xử lý lỗi chuỗi không tồn tại hoặc rỗng. Còn tuỳ thuộc vào yêu cầu và logic của công việc, bạn có thể thực hiện các hành động xử lý khác tùy theo trường hợp cụ thể.

Hãy mô tả cách áp dụng hàm Len() trong VBA để kiểm tra và xử lý các lỗi như chuỗi không tồn tại hoặc rỗng.

_HOOK_

 

Đang xử lý...